📜  CSS 和PHP之间的差异(1)

📅  最后修改于: 2023-12-03 15:30:11.030000             🧑  作者: Mango

CSS 和 PHP之间的差异

CSS和PHP都是WEB开发中非常重要的技术,尽管都可以用于美化网页,但它们在实现方式和应用场景上有很大的不同。以下是CSS和PHP之间的主要差异:

1. 用途

CSS主要用于样式设计,它可以控制HTML元素的样式,比如字体、颜色、大小、边框、背景等。PHP则更多地用于后端编程,可以处理表单、数据库、文件等功能,并且在Web应用中实现各种复杂的逻辑和业务。

2. 语法

CSS使用层叠样式表,在HTML中通过标签、类名或ID来应用样式。它的语法结构较为简单,主要由选择器和属性构成,如下所示:

p { 
  color:red; 
  font-size:14px; 
}

PHP则采用C语言风格的语法,具有更强的表达能力和逻辑处理能力。常用的语法元素包括变量、条件语句、循环语句、函数等,如下所示:

$num = 10;
if ($num > 0) {
  for ($i=0; $i<$num; $i++) {
    echo "The number is: " . $i . "<br>";
  }
}
3. 工作原理

CSS通过浏览器的渲染引擎实现页面的样式效果,主要处理视觉方面的内容。PHP则在服务器端执行,可以实现各种业务逻辑和交互效果,与数据库、文件系统等进行交互。

4. 应用场景

CSS适合实现网页的浏览器端UI设计,可以提高网页的美观性和用户体验。PHP适用于Web应用的服务器端编程,可以实现各种复杂的逻辑和功能。

5. 熟练度要求

掌握CSS需要熟悉CSS的语法、选择器、属性等基础知识,熟练掌握网页设计的工具和技巧。掌握PHP需要熟悉PHP的语言特性、面向对象编程、数据库操作等知识,能够快速编写Web应用。

总之,CSS和PHP虽然有一定的相似性,但它们的应用场景和工作模式存在较大的差异。只有熟练掌握它们的特点和应用,方能更好地应用于网页设计和Web应用开发。